Q: Is 21,141,228 a Prime Number?
A: No, 21,141,228 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 21141228 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 12 251 502 753 1,004 1,506 3,012 7,019 14,038 21,057 28,076 42,114 84,228 1,761,769 3,523,538 5,285,307 7,047,076 10,570,614 and 21,141,228, with no remainder.
Since 21,141,228 cannot be divided by just 1 and 21,141,228, it is not a prime number.
